This virtual cache is located at Fort Portobelo, in the Portobelo National Park located along the Caribbean Sea coastline. This fort and market town was founded in the late 1500s. In the 1600s the fort and town was the site of much trading , pirate activity as well as a primary pathway for the transportation of Gold, silver and precious stones to Spain and Europe. Also interesting and worthy of exploring is the legend and story of the Black Christ (at the little church in this immediate area), as well as the Customs House (built in 1630) where gold and silver was protected and stored while awaiting shipment.
